Cleaning Out Your Freezer Before Moving Home

Article Image

As the name implies, a freezer exists to keep food at or below freezing temperature. There are a few reasons for this. The first is that some foods may melt if not frozen, which would ruin them. Others are kept frozen as a preservative measure. Bacteria activity is slowed greatly at low temperatures which allows for foods to keep for longer. As useful as this is, it presents a problem when moving home. You can't transport your freezer unless it is empty, but if the contents of the freezer isn't in the freezer it could melt or go off. This article will give you tips on what you can do to deal with this problem.

Chilly Bins

One option that you have for dealing with frozen foodstuffs is to use one or more chilly bins. Chilly bins are boxes that are designed to insulate the inside to prevent heat from getting in. This does not last indefinitely, but it definitely helps to keep things cool for a lot longer. By using these, it is possible to transport your food that needs to be kept frozen to your new home. The viability of this option will depend on a few different factors. The biggest one is the distance. If you are having to travel a long distance to get to your new home, the chances are, the food will not longer be frozen by the time you get there. To use this option you will need to be as quick as possible. So, it will only work when there is not a long distance. The other factor that you will have to consider is the weather. The hotter the weather is, the less time you will have before everything thaws. Deciding on whether it will work requires a lot of personal judgement by weighing up these factors.

Use up the food

Other than transporting the food, your other option, if you don't want to throw it out, is to use it up. There are a few ways to do this. One way is to plan your meals leading up to the move and shop for food with this planning in mind. This means that you will be using up everything that you buy. When planning your meals, try to pick dishes that will use up some of your existing ingredients so that you can use up what you had in the freezer prior to your period of planning. For things that are in the freezer that are not used in meals, ice cream for example, just be mindful of the fact that it exists and use it up over the period leading up to the move. The more structured your planning is of your meals, the more effective this method will be. In theory, you should be able to end up with an empty freezer by the time you have to move. There are also other benefits to this. By planning out your meals, you will be able to save money. This is because you will not be buying things that you will not use. Meal planning also allows you to do things such as meal preparation ahead of time. For example if you are cutting up vegetables for a dish and you know that you will be using those same vegetables later in the week, you can cut it all up now, store it and save time later. This is the most effective way to use up all of the items in your freezer.
